In April 1980, a tense standoff unfolds as heavily armed assailants seize control of the Iranian Embassy in London. As the world watches with bated breath, elite SAS commandos hatch a daring plan to liberate the hostages and neutralize the threat in a high-stakes operation that will test their mettle like never before.

Location

Iranian Embassy, Kensington, London

The Iranian Embassy in Kensington, London, became the center of a tense hostage situation in 1980. This historic building is known for its architectural significance and is situated in a prominent area, often bustling with activity. The location's high-profile nature drew intense media coverage and government scrutiny during the crisis.

Salim (Ben Turner)

Salim is a determined and cold-blooded leader of the terrorists who orchestrates the hostage crisis. His ruthless demeanor is matched by his strategic mind, as he takes advantage of the situation to exert pressure on the British government. Salim's character embodies the darker aspects of human nature driven by ideological fervor and desperation.

Lance Corporal Rusty Firmin (Jamie Bell)

Lance Corporal Rusty Firmin is a resourceful and courageous member of the SAS. His character embodies bravery and a commitment to protect the hostages, working under pressure to devise a rescue plan. Rusty's tactical skills and quick thinking prove essential as he navigates a volatile environment filled with uncertainty and danger.

Chief Inspector Max Vernon (Mark Strong)

Chief Inspector Max Vernon is the chief negotiator tasked with managing the crisis. He is calm under pressure and utilizes his negotiation skills to diffuse the situation and secure the safety of the hostages. His character highlights the challenges of balancing authority and empathy in high-stakes negotiations.

Kate Adie (Abbie Cornish)

Kate Adie is a determined BBC reporter on the scene, providing insight into the media's role during crises. Her character represents the pursuit of truth and the complexities of reporting in dangerous situations. Kate's presence emphasizes the public interest in the unfolding drama and the pressure it puts on the authorities.
